The beginning of the year in 1st grade is dedicated to lots of review and assessing where students are after a long summer break. This booklet that I have students create is a great way to see what children know about numbers 1-20. It includes collage pieces for number words, tallies, dominoes, tens frames, dice, and base ten blocks.

In the expanded form, we break up a number according to the place value of digits and expand it to show the value of each digit. For example, the expanded form of 943 is given below. 943 = 9 hundreds + 4 tens + 3 ones. My " Math About Me " includes the following facts: My name has 2^3 letters in it. I have (-2 x -1) siblings. My husband and I have been together for 733 days. I like to collect books and writing utensils and own over 10^3 of them! My favorite thing to share is my mental math skills which I learned 5^2+1 years ago.

I call it Math About Me. Each child gets a foam poster board and finds pictures about himself or herself. They decorate their boards with pictures and items that represent them.Then they write captions using numbers in their life.
